Dededededensan produced by PASS THE BATON will be exhibiting at NEWoMan Shinjuku (January 28 - February 6).
"Dedededensan" is a project that shines a light on traditional crafts from an unconventional perspective, reimagining them as items that can be used in modern life.
We have previously exhibited at PASS THE BATON MARKET, but this time we will be holding a POP UP event at NEWoMan Shinjuku.
Eight unique traditional craftspeople from all over Japan have gathered to present their adorable crafts that you'll want to use every day. Please look forward to it!
▶ Exhibitor Introduction
Koshin Kiln -AGANO Yaki (Pottery) (Fukuoka) / Shiraki Crafts-YAME Chochin (Lanterns) (Fukuoka) / Okamoto Textiles- Nishijin NISHIJIN Ori (Textiles) (Kyoto) / Kenichi Kiln- Mashiko MASHIKO Yaki (Pottery) (Tochigi) / Ikeda-YAMANAKA Shikki (Lacquerware) (Ishikawa) / Tomioka Shoten-Kaba Zaiku (Cherry Bark Work) (Akita) / Ukibori-sha-KAMAKURA Bori (Wood Carvings and Lacquerware) (Kanagawa) / Wajima Kirimoto-WAJIMA Nuri (Lacquerware) (Ishikawa)
*Dedededensan is a joint project between the Japan Traditional Crafts Industry Promotion Association (commonly known as the Densan Association) and PASS THE BATON.
